“SEEING”
In seeing, there is only seeing ; there is neither a seer nor a seen.
This is non-duality, truth.
On the other hand, the mind, the personal “I,” believes it is “seeing,” it is actually not “seeing,” but always a one-sided, biased comparison based on self-absorbed values by stories fabricated through self-hypnosis, and it always claims a dogmatic, self-righteous judgment.
Its world is always built on the basis of duality by self-percieving separate “I” as the subject.
This world of duality is always relative, and because of its nature, it can never escape the natural law of impermanence.
Therefore, no matter how much effort is put into pursuing an ideal, and no matter how many people agree with it, and moreover, even if it’s difficult to notice, or even if we don’t want to notice, in fact this duality, where there is always something contradictory, can never become absolute.
In other words, no matter what the ideal, it can never be fulfilled.
This is the relative world of duality that is actually fruitless, where the mind desperately fights for tryimg to make impermanence into permanence, and where it keeps clinging illusion it unconsciously projected.
“Seeing” does never exist there, but there is only preconceived notions and secondhand knowledge. (OM 🙏)
